Isaiah walks 3 miles due north, turns and then 5 miles due east. How far is he from his starting point?

For #1, we have the two legs of the triangle and must find the hypotenuse.  Using the Pythagorean theorem, we have:
3²+5²=x²
9+25=x²
34=x²
√34 = x ≈ 5.8 mi

Find the value of r so the line that passes through the pair of points has the given slope. (3, 5), (−3, r), m=34
frez [133]

The value (y2) of r = 1/2.

This question relates to equation of a straight line but we are looking for the slope in this case.

<h3>Slope</h3>

This is the ratio to which we measure the change along the y-axis to the change along the x-axis. The formula is given as

m = \frac{y_2 - y_1}{x_2 - x_1}

Data given;

  • x1  = 3
  • x2 = -3
  • y1 = 5
  • y2 = r
  • m = 34 or 3/4

Substitute the values into the equation and solve for the unknown

NB; we are assuming that the slope here is 34 and not 3/4.

m = \frac{y_2 - y_1}{x_2 - x_1} \\34 = \frac{r - 5}{-3 - 3}\\34 = \frac{r - 5}{-6}\\

cross multiply both sides and make r the subject of formula

34 * -6 = r - 5\\-204 = r - 5\\r = -204+5\\r = -199

the value of r = -199.

This is not mathematically obtainable and we would use 3/4 as the value of slope

\frac{3}{4}= \frac{r - 5}{-3 - 3}\\\frac{3}{4}=\frac{r - 5}{-6}\\4(r-5) = 3 * -6\\4r- 20 = -18\\4r = -18 +20\\4r = 2\\r = \frac{1}{2}

The most logical value of r = 1/2
